Moving into your first home is exciting, but it can also feel overwhelming. Many people only realise how much work is involved when moving day arrives. Small mistakes can quickly lead to stress, delays, damaged items, and unexpected costs.
This guide highlights the most common mistakes first-time movers make and, more importantly, how to avoid them—so your move feels organised, calm, and under control.
1. Leaving Planning Too Late
One of the most common mistakes is waiting until the last minute to organise the move. Without a plan, packing becomes rushed and important tasks are easy to forget.
How to avoid it:
Create a simple moving checklist at least four to six weeks before your move. Book services early, especially during busy periods, to avoid higher costs and limited availability.
2. Underestimating How Much You Own
Many first-time movers are surprised by how much they’ve accumulated over time. This often results in more boxes, more trips, and extra expense.
How to avoid it:
Declutter before you start packing. Donate, sell, or dispose of items you no longer use. Moving fewer items saves time, effort, and money.
3. Packing Without a Clear System
Packing items randomly into boxes makes unpacking frustrating and increases the risk of breakages.
How to avoid it:
Pack one room at a time and label every box clearly. If you’re short on time or want peace of mind, a professional packing service can ensure everything is packed safely and logically.
4. Forgetting to Measure Furniture
A common moving-day problem is discovering that furniture won’t fit through doors, hallways, or staircases.
How to avoid it:
Measure large items in advance and compare them with doorways and access points. This prevents delays and avoids unnecessary damage.

6. Forgetting an Essentials Box
Many first-time movers forget to keep everyday items easily accessible on moving day.
How to avoid it:
Pack a clearly labelled essentials box with items like chargers, toiletries, important documents, and basic kitchen supplies. Keep it with you, not in the moving van.
